探索Windows Server系列中内存占用最低的选择
结论:在Windows Server系列中,寻找内存占用最低的版本并非单纯比较各个版本的系统需求,而是要综合考虑实际应用、负载和优化策略。尽管Windows Server 2008 R2因其较低的官方推荐内存要求而可能被视为“内存占用低”的选项,但现代的Windows Server 2019和2022通过更高效的资源管理和优化,实现在高负载下的更低内存占用。因此,选择哪一版本取决于具体的工作负载和环境优化。
分析探讨:
Windows Server操作系统是全球企业广泛使用的服务器平台,其内存占用率是影响性能和效率的关键因素之一。从官方推荐配置来看,Windows Server 2008 R2的最低内存要求为512MB,这在早期的服务器操作系统中显得较为亲民。然而,由于技术的发展,新的Windows Server版本如2016、2019及2022虽然提高了最低内存要求(例如,2019推荐的最低内存为2GB),但它们在内存管理和资源优化上有了显著提升。
首先,新版本的Windows Server引入了更多内建的内存管理工具和策略,如动态内存(Dynamic Memory)和内存气泡(Memory Ballooning)。这些功能可以智能地分配和调整服务器内存,确保在多任务环境下,每个应用都能得到合理且高效的内存使用,从而降低整体的内存占用。
其次,Windows Server 2019和2022在虚拟化方面有显著进步,尤其是在Hyper-V上。这使得服务器能在不增加物理内存消耗的情况下,高效地运行多个虚拟机。此外,对于大数据、云计算和容器化的支持,新版本的Windows Server在内存管理上更加精细化,能更好地应对复杂工作负载。
然而,这并不意味着新版本的Windows Server在所有情况下都会比旧版本占用更少的内存。实际的内存占用很大程度上取决于服务器的角色和应用。例如,如果服务器主要用于数据库服务,那么内存占用可能会因为数据缓存的需求而增加。因此,选择哪个版本更“内存占用低”,需要根据特定的工作负载和业务需求来评估。
总的来说,虽然Windows Server 2008 R2的内存要求相对较低,但考虑到现代服务器环境的复杂性和对性能的需求,Windows Server 2019和2022通过更先进的内存管理和优化,往往能在高负载下实现更低的内存占用。然而,具体选择应基于实际业务场景,结合服务器的角色、预期负载以及内存管理策略来决定。
CDNK博客